Apple Cider Honey Muffins

Deliciously moist muffins infused with the flavors of apple cider and honey, perfect for fall.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up apple cider
  • 1/2 cup honey
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on nutmeg
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, mix the melted butter, honey, brown sugar, and eggs until well combined.
  4. Stir in the apple cider into the wet ingredients.
  5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ring until just combined.
  6. Fill each muffin cup about 2/3 full with the batter.
  7. Bake for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  8. Let the muffins cool in the pan for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Notes

  • For added flavor, consider adding chopped apples or walnuts to the batter.
  • Store muffins in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
  • These muffins freeze well; wrap them individually and store in the freezer for up to 2 months.
